Glycolic acid is an Alpha Hydroxy Acid (AHA) that works wonders by gently exfoliating the surface layer of your skin. This means it helps to shed dead skin cells, unclog pores, and improve overall skin texture. For body concerns like 'bacne' (back acne) or bumpy arms (keratosis pilaris), it's incredibly effective because it prevents those dead skin cells from building up and causing blockages. Plus, it can help fade post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ation, leaving your skin looking much clearer and smoother. My Go-To Glycolic Acid Body Routine Here’s how I’ve been using The Ordinary Glycolic Acid 7% Toning Solution to target my body and back acne concerns: Step 1: Prep is Key (Night Time Only!) I always start with clean, dry skin. After my evening shower, I make sure my skin is completely dry. This is crucial for optimal absorption and to avoid any unnecessary irritation. Step 2: Smart Application for Body Areas Instead of a small cotton pad, I've found a few tricks for easier application on larger areas. For my back, I sometimes pour a small amount into a clean spray bottle (designated just for this product!) and gently mist it, then pat it in. For my chest, shoulders, and arms, I pour a bit into my clean hands and gently pat it onto the skin. You don't need a lot – just enough to lightly cover the area. This method is great for "applying glycolic acid on body" and getting full coverage. Step 3: Frequency & Listening to Your Skin When I first started, I applied it 2-3 times a week. Now, I use it on alternative nights, especially on my back where I battle occasional breakouts. The key is to listen to your skin. Step 4: Follow with Hydration Once the glycolic acid has absorbed (usually a minute or two), I follow up with a gentle, non-comedogenic body lotion. This helps to lock in moisture and prevent any potential dryness that exfoliating acids can sometimes cause. Essential Tips & Warnings You MUST Know SPF is Your Best Friend (Non-Negotiable!): This cannot be stressed enough. Glycolic acid makes your skin more sensitive to the sun. Even if you apply it at night, you must "always wear SPF" on any treated body areas during the day. I use a broad-spectrum SPF 30+ daily on my chest, shoulders, and any other exposed skin. This can lead to over-exfoliation, irritation, and damage to your skin barrier. If you use other chemical exfoliants or retinoids, alternate the nights you use them. Patch Test First: Always do a patch test on a small, inconspicuous area of your body before applying it liberally, especially if you have sensitive skin. Do Not Use on Broken Skin: Avoid applying glycolic acid to broken, irritated, or freshly shaved skin. After consistently following this routine, I've seen a significant improvement in my body skin.
